6 new shows are now on sale at the New Theatre


As we enter the last few months of 2015, the New Theatre has announced SIX new productions for 2016. Adding to what is already a jam-packed schedule of shows, Cardiff will host two critically acclaimed musicals, two classic American plays, the adaptation of a much-loved British novel, and the world-famous Royal Shakespeare Company.

America is painted in two very different lights by Guys and Dolls and American Idiot. Guys & Dolls is set in the sizzling New York world of gangsters, gamblers and nightclub singers, and features classic Broadway tunes such as Luck be a Lady and My Time of Day. American Idiot, on the other hand, is set in a post 9/11 world, following the changing lives of three boyhood friends. It’s an explosive show featuring songs from Green Day’s award-winning album of the same name.

The American invasion of Cardiff continues with two modern literary classics. After their excellent rendition of Hamlet this year, Theatr Clwyd will return to the New with Tennessee Williams’ Pulitzer prize-winning Cat on a Hot Tin Roof. Two months later, an adaptation of John Steinbeck’s iconic novel Of Mice and Men also arrives, following the friendship between migrant workers George and Lennie. Both plays explore family and relationships during and just after the Great Depression, and are essential viewing.

Another classic much closer to home is the wonderfully uplifting Goodnight Mister Tom, based on the multi-award winning children’s book by Michelle Magorian. As World War Two looms on the horizon, a friendship blossoms between young evacuee William Beech and Mister Tom, the elderly recluse who has taken him in.

Finishing off this set of new shows is Royal Shakespeare Company’s production of A Midsummer Night’s Dream. Billed as A Play for the Nation, the RSC come to Cardiff as part of a big UK tour. The principle cast will be played by RSC professional actors, while Bottom and the Mechanicals will be played by amateur actors from Cardiff’s Everyman Theatre.
